Over the past few years, you've heard a lot about the 1976 Olympic gold medalist in the decathlon for reasons other than sports. But while training and attending Graceland College in Lamoni, he was known as Bruce Jenner. Jenner actually attended Graceland on a football scholarship, but had to stop playing due to an knee injury. Graceland track coach L.D. Weldon saw his athletic potential, though, and Jenner began training for the decathlon, making his debut in the event in the 1970 Drake relays. He finished fifth, and later qualified for the 1972 U.S. Olympic team in the event. He finished tenth in the Munich games, and after graduating from Graceland the following year, continued his training, selling insurance at night to make ends meet, all the while aiming his sights at Montreal in 1976. As ABC's Keith Jackson called the final race in the 10 event competition, Jenner racked up 8,616 points in the 1976 games, smashing the world record he had just said at the U.S. Olympic trials by nearly 100 points. The iconic image of Jenner carrying a small American flag during that victory lap is etched in many of our memories. In fact, it started a tradition that is now common among winning athletes. Bruce Jenner became just the second person to be pictured on the front of a weedy cereal box. Today's generation knows Jenner for reality television shows and publicly discussing gender identification. But it was Graceland alum Bruce Jenner who won Olympic gold and the title of world's greatest athlete on this date in 1976. And that's Iowa Almanac for July 30th. Follow us on Twitter @IowaAlmanac.
